didn’t just lead Rabun County—he controlled everything. The senior point guard put up 19.1 PPG, 9.6 APG, 4.2 RPG and nearly 2 SPG, finishing top 10 nationally in assists per game. Navy-signee is a true floor general with scoring punch—capable of dropping 29 in the state title game while still facilitating at a high level. His ability to live in the paint, create for others and dictate tempo makes him one of the most complete lead guards in the state.

Huey dictated the tempo from tip to buzzer, serving as a primary offensive catalyst. His one-on-one scoring was operating at peak efficiency, backed by unwavering confidence. He flashed high-level vision with creative no-look assists and broke defenders down with explosive, shifty handle moves—crosses and spins that created constant separation. Perimeter containment was a problem all night, as he blended assertive scoring with strong lead-guard command. He stayed locked in offensively and delivered a complete, high-impact performance and secured the MVP.

Arguably the state’s most impactful point guard, the dazzling playmaker has improved each and every season. Through the first three games of his senior campaign, Huey has orchestrated the Wildcat offense to perfection averaging 21.3 points, 3.3 rebounds, 12 assists and 1.7 steals. Blalock’s toughness, shiftiness, court vision and overall skill make him pound-for-pound as good as it gets in the backcourt in Georgia. Navy offered in September.

Dazzling passer. Elite pace with the ball. Excels at changing speeds. Strong, zippy passes. Sparks fastbreaks with his outlet passing. Keeps his dribble alive as a probing playmaker. Passes teammates open and elevates those around him. Fierce competitor. Scrappy defender. Shot close to 39% from beyond the arc as a junior. Undersized but elevates well to finish in traffic. The epitome of being the head of the snake.

Dynamic point guard is one of if not the best passer in Georgia. A true catalyst, Blalock is the engine that makes all of his teams go and is possibly the most valuable player in Class A D-I. Dazzling playmaker makes others around him better. Deep three-point range. Has become an explosive leaper for his height. Comfortable probing defenses in traffic. Averaged 19.9 points, 3 rebounds, 8.3 assists and 2.8 steals per game. Earned a Young Harris offer in December.

Foul trouble sank the Cats, having to sit for most of the second quarter after leading 12-7 after one. High motor. Smallest player on the floor but is a good leaper and has a nose for the ball. Sneaks in for offensive putbacks. Scores well in transition, able to convert live ball turnovers into points. Sees the floor very well and has deep range on his jump shot. Scored all his points inside the arc against Mt. Pisgah. Got to the basket efficiently. Posted 20 points, 7 rebounds, 2 assists and 2 steals.

One of North Georgia’s most exciting playmakers, Huey has upped his production as a sophomore from 7.4 points, 2.5 rebounds, 5.6 assists and 1.3 steals to 15.9 points, 4.7 rebounds, 7.8 assists and 2.1 steals. The undersized point guard has increased his three-point shooting average from 28% to 36%.
